Today sees the launch of the first of the St Giles Wise partnership contracts; the third sector/social enterprise partnership has been recognised as having the potential for lasting impact and innovation in public sector services delivering positive results for the people they support. The Wise Group and St Giles came together 2 years ago to form a partnership with the aim of supporting the Probation Resettlement reforms by offering a high-quality service underpinned by staff who have lived experience and cultural competency. Get the latest from the St Giles Newsletter. The partnership of these two charitiesrespondsto changes in the Probation Service and both organisations have been in talks since April 2019. Creating new and exciting partnerships to provide services to those who need it most is what it does, and in a new first it has created a formal strategic partnership with St Giles, St Giles Wise, to successfully bid for 16 Ministry of Justice contracts providing support and services to prison leavers across England and Wales.
